Analysis

In 2020, share of population living in rural areas in Suriname stood at 29.2%. That is the lowest value across all 15 years on record.

The figure is down 10.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share of population living in rural areas in Suriname peaked at 56.5% in 1950 and was at its lowest, 29.2%, in 2020.

That places Suriname 98th out of 236 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 15 years of available data.

Share of population living in rural areas in Suriname, year by year

Annual values for Share of population living in rural areas in Suriname, 1950 to 2020.
Year % Change
1950 56.5%
1955 53.3% -5.7%
1960 49.5% -7.1%
1965 44.9% -9.2%
1970 40.9% -9.0%
1975 39.8% -2.6%
1980 37.6% -5.6%
1985 37.0% -1.5%
1990 37.4% +1.0%
1995 37.3% -0.1%
2000 37.6% +0.7%
2005 36.3% -3.5%
2010 32.6% -10.3%
2015 31.4% -3.4%
2020 29.2% -7.0%
